Reverse description Demeter standing facing, wearing a modius crown and long veil, arms extended to either side, holding a lit torch in each hand. To the left of the goddess, the diminutive figure of Telesphorus stands facing, clad in his characteristic hooded cloak (cucullus). The reverse legend ΔΙΟΝΥϹΟΠΟΛΕΙΤΩΝ ΤΟ Ο, identifying the civic mint of Dionysopolis and the regnal year Ο (= 70), is distributed around the field within a dotted border.
